A cycling jacket is a specialized outerwear garment designed to provide cyclists with protection from the elements while riding. Here’s a description of a typical cycling jacket:
Material: Cycling jackets are usually constructed from lightweight yet durable materials such as polyester, nylon, or a blend of synthetic fabrics. These materials offer windproof, water-resistant, and breathable properties to keep cyclists comfortable in various weather conditions.
Design: Cycling jackets often feature a form-fitting design tailored specifically for riding. The jacket typically has a longer back to provide coverage in the riding position and may include a dropped tail to protect against spray from the rear wheel. The sleeves are designed to accommodate the extended reach of cycling, allowing for freedom of movement without bunching up.
Weather Protection: Cycling jackets are designed to shield cyclists from wind, rain, and cold temperatures. Many jackets feature windproof and water-resistant or waterproof membranes to block out moisture and keep the rider dry during inclement weather. Some jackets also incorporate breathable membranes or ventilation panels to prevent overheating and moisture buildup during intense activity.
Visibility: Safety is a priority for cyclists, especially when riding in low-light conditions. Many cycling jackets include reflective elements such as piping, logos, or strips strategically placed to enhance visibility to motorists and other road users, improving safety when riding in dimly lit environments or at night.
Pockets: Cycling jackets often come equipped with pockets for storing essentials such as energy gels, keys, or a smartphone. These pockets are usually positioned for easy access and may feature zipper closures to secure items during the ride.
Adjustability: To ensure a snug and comfortable fit, cycling jackets may feature adjustable cuffs, hem, and collar. These adjustable features allow cyclists to customize the fit of the jacket to their preferences and weather conditions, helping to seal out drafts and maintain warmth.
Packability: Many cycling jackets are designed to be lightweight and packable, making them easy to stow away in a jersey pocket or backpack when not in use. This feature is particularly useful for cyclists who need to layer up or down depending on changing weather conditions during their ride.
Overall, a cycling jacket is an essential piece of gear for cyclists, providing protection and comfort in various weather conditions, while also offering visibility and practical features tailored for riding.
